Wheel bearings are precision components that facilitate the smooth and effortless rotation of wheels around their axles. They consist of two primary components: an inner race that fits onto the axle and an outer race that is pressed into the wheel hub. Between these races, an assembly of small steel balls or rollers allows for minimal friction and maximum efficiency in wheel movement.

The cost of replacing Honda Civic wheel bearings can vary depending on the bearing type, labor charges, and location. Generally, the front wheel bearings tend to be more expensive to replace than the rear ones. The total cost can range from $250 to $600 per wheel, including parts and labor.
